Chris and Amelia fell in love with this little house while they were still renovating another house 100 yards up the road.

Fortunately they were able to complete and sell the other house, freeing them up to begin the renovating process on this one.
Built in the 1920s, the house was in a fairly bad state of decline and it has been no small task to give some beauty and functionality back to the old girl.
Amelia has been the chief interior designer, choosing most of the style, colours and fixtures. Her choice of the whitewashed floors, using Resene Colorwood Whitewash, is stunning and has had fantastic feedback, and also helps to add more light. The kitchen light is an old industrial shade Amelia found at a garage sale. A Resene auto spray was used to bring it back to life. It too is stunning and also very functional as well.
Chris and Amelia are about two thirds through the do-up and are planning for the exterior next. Amelia is currently sorting through her many Resene testpots and a decision will be made shortly.

The dining room walls are finished in Resene Zylone Sheen tinted to Resene Quarter Tea. The same colour extends into the kitchen in Resene SpaceCote Flat Kitchen & Bathroom with white on the ceiling. The splashback is also in Resene Quarter Tea. The dining room table has been prepared with Resene Waterborne Smooth Surface Sealer and the thought is to clear finish it just to protect the existing look.
